Why Dehydrate Food?

  • Save money. Buy food on sale, in bulk purchases, buy additional fruits and vegetables in season and or use all of your garden harvest. Use a food dehydrator to preserve the extra food and save money.
  • Great taste. In particular, drying fruits reduces the water content concentrates the fruit’s natural sugars and makes each bite a mouth watering burst of flavor.
  • Dehydrating is easy. There are three basic steps – wash, slice and dry. Food dehydrating is much easier than canning or freezing.
  • Save Space. Dried Foods substantially shrink as 80 to 90% of their water content is removed during dehydration. This makes dehydrated foods easier and smaller to store versus canned or frozen foods.
  • Dried foods are healthy. Drying largely preserves nutrients and enzymes and, unlike processed food, does not contain additives or preservatives.
